The Wisconsin Natural Resources Board (NRB) approved a scope statement at its April 10 meeting that will allow the DNR to begin drafting rules that would allow anglers to harvest walleyes in the Minocqua Chain of Lakes this summer now that the Lac du Flambeau tribe has declared its intent to spear the chain this spring.
